Product Description:
136X5218 is a Danfoss drive from the VLT FC 51 micro drive series. It is a compact and powerful drive that can be parameterized via PC software. PCBs on the unit are coated for added protection and safety. Features and benefits of micro drives include support for adjacent mounting, RFI filters for interference suppression, heat sink for cooling, and energy efficiency. For PC programming a serial link that connects to the onboard RS-485 interface can be used. The control software is available for download from the Danfoss website. A local control panel is also available for monitoring and control. A large display and navigation keys provide ease of use and intuitive drive control. The 136X5218 drive is designed for three-phase input at 380 to 480 Volts. The typical motor shaft output of the unit is 0.75 kilowatts (1 Horsepower).
At 380 to 440 Volts, the continuous output is 2.2 Amps and the intermittent output is 3.3 Amps. At 440 to 480 Volts, the continuous output is 2.1 Amps and the intermittent output is 3.2 Amps. At 380 to 440 Volts, the continuous input is 3.5 Amps and the intermittent input is 4.7 Amps. At 440 to 480 Volts, the continuous input is 3.0 Amps and the intermittent input is 4.0 Amps. The best case power loss during operating is 28.5 Watts and the typical value is 43.5 Watts. The best case drive efficiency is 97.4% and the typical value is 96%. For both the mains and motor connection, the largest cable size is 10 AWG or 4 mm2. Mounting orientation of the IP20 rated drive unit is vertical and its weight is 1.1 kilograms.

Q: Is integrated temperature monitoring available?
A: Integrated monitoring of heat sink temperature is available.
